**PCB Laser Machine Market Application Insights   **

The  PCB Laser Machine Market, particularly within the Application segment, demonstrates notable growth potential as it reflects a diversified landscape encompassing various types of circuit boards. As of 2023, the overall market stands at 2.21 USD billion, anticipated to grow substantially in the coming years. The Flexible Circuit Boards segment has emerged as a significant player, accounting for a valuation of 0.7 USD billion in 2023 and is expected to grow to 1.1 USD billion by 2032.

This segment's dominance can be attributed to the increasing demand for lightweight and compact electronic applications across consumer electronics and automotive industries, thereby showcasing its pivotal role in the market dynamics.In contrast, the Rigid Circuit Boards segment holds a valuation of 0.65 USD billion in 2023 and is projected to reach 1.05 USD billion by 2032. This segment remains critical due to its widespread use in traditional electronic devices, ensuring its steady demand. Rigid circuit boards facilitate robust functionality and reliability, making them highly favored among manufacturers, thus playing a significant role in the overall market growth.

Meanwhile, the Rigid-Flex Circuit Boards segment, valued at 0.46 USD billion in 2023, with a projected increase to 0.75 USD billion by 2032, caters to specialized applications that require a combination of flexibility and rigidity. Their utility in complex assemblies and portable devices reinforces their importance within the PCB Laser Machine Market, particularly as industries demand innovations in lightweight and streamlined designs.Lastly, the Multilayer Circuit Boards segment, though valued at a smaller 0.4 USD billion in 2023, is forecasted to grow to 0.6 USD billion by 2032.

While it represents a smaller portion of the market, multilayer boards are essential for high-density electronic applications, thus helping to compact larger volumes of circuitry into limited spaces. The increasing integration of advanced technologies in sectors such as telecommunications and computing drives the need for multilayer circuit boards, indicating their strategic relevance in the market. Overall, the  PCB Laser Machine Market segmentation reveals a heterogeneous landscape with flexible circuit boards dominating the space, driven by innovation and consumer demand, while rigid, rigid-flex, and multilayer segments contribute significantly to the complete market value and functionality.

**PCB Laser Machine Market Machine Type Insights   **

The  PCB Laser Machine Market, valued at 2.21 billion USD in 2023, showcases a diverse landscape in its Machine Type segmentation. The growth of the market is significantly driven by advancements in laser technology, which enhance precision and efficiency in PCB manufacturing. CO2 Laser Machines dominate this segment due to their effectiveness in cutting and engraving non-metals, making them indispensable in the electronics industry.

On the other hand, Fiber Laser Machines are gaining traction for their energy efficiency and ability to process metals, showcasing a promising growth pathway.Nd: YAG Laser Machines are also notable for their capability in specific applications such as welding and drilling, contributing to their sustained relevance. Additionally, Ultrafast Laser Machines are carving a niche due to their precision in micromachining and minimal thermal impact, ideal for sensitive components.

Overall, the segmentation of the  PCB Laser Machine Market reveals crucial insights into market dynamics, highlighting trends towards increased customization, efficiency, and the shift towards more sophisticated laser technologies to meet industry demands.As the market evolves, these factors create both opportunities and challenges, driving innovation across the sector.

**PCB Laser Machine Market Regional Insights   **

The Regional segment of the  PCB Laser Machine Market showcases a diverse range of market values, with North America leading at 0.94 USD Billion in 2023, expected to grow to 1.48 USD Billion by 2032, indicating its majority holding in market share. Europe follows significantly, holding a value of 0.68 USD Billion in 2023, expected to rise to 1.07 USD Billion, reflecting its important role in the industry.

The APAC region, valued at 0.43 USD Billion in 2023, is projected to grow to 0.65 USD Billion, illustrating significant growth potential due to increasing electronics manufacturing.In contrast, South America and MEA are smaller markets with values of 0.09 USD Billion and 0.07 USD Billion, respectively, in 2023, and although they show growth to 0.15 USD Billion and 0.09 USD Billion, they remain less dominant, suggesting opportunities for future expansion. This segmentation underscores the varied market dynamics across regions, influenced by local industry demands, technological advancements, and investment in electronics manufacturing.

The  PCB Laser Machine Market's growth is propelled by increasing demand for precision and efficiency in PCB manufacturing processes across these regions.
